Redwick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Redwick Come From? nationality or country of origin

The last name Redwick is found in The United States more than any other country/territory. It can also appear as a variant:. Click here to see other potential spellings of this last name.

How Common Is The Last Name Redwick? popularity and diffusion

This last name is the 3,957,383rd most frequently occurring family name worldwide. It is borne by around 1 in 291,501,837 people. This last name occurs mostly in The Americas, where 76 percent of Redwick live; 76 percent live in North America and 76 percent live in Anglo-North America.

It is most commonly used in The United States, where it is borne by 13 people, or 1 in 27,881,456. In The United States it is most frequent in: Michigan, where 100 percent live. Not including The United States this last name occurs in 4 countries. It is also common in Canada, where 24 percent live and England, where 16 percent live.

Redwick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The occurrence of Redwick has changed over time. In The United States the number of people who held the Redwick surname expanded 186 percent between 1880 and 2014.

Redwick Last Name Statistics demography

In The United States those holding the Redwick surname are 46.77% more likely to be registered with the Democratic Party than the national average, with 100% registered with the party.

Redwick earn somewhat more than the average income. In United States they earn 12.33% more than the national average, earning $48,469 USD per year.
